Listening Circles for Native Youth in Oklahoma

Oklahoma is home to a diverse population of Native American tribes, yet many Native youth face unique challenges related to cultural identity and community support. Reports indicate that these young individuals often experience feelings of isolation and disconnection from both their cultural roots and contemporary society. Such barriers contribute to a significant need for initiatives that prioritize the voices and experiences of Native youth, fostering environments where they can share their stories and connect with one another.

In communities throughout Oklahoma, particularly in rural and tribal areas, the lack of safe spaces for open dialogue poses a significant challenge. Young people often feel unheard or undervalued, leading to struggles with mental health and community engagement. This disconnection is especially pronounced in areas where access to resources and supportive networks is limited, further emphasizing the need for culturally relevant programs that can effectively address these issues.

This grant aims to fund listening circles for Native youth across the state, providing an intentional space for participants to share their experiences, challenges, and aspirations. By integrating traditional practices and community rituals into these dialogues, the initiative not only supports healing but also reinforces cultural identity and belonging. The unique approach of these listening circles offers a platform for youth to express themselves and receive validation from their peers, creating a sense of unity and shared purpose within their communities.

Implementing listening circles in Oklahoma directly responds to the specific needs of Native youth, prioritizing their voices and experiences. The format encourages open expression and mutual support, vital for fostering a sense of agency and empowerment. Furthermore, this initiative is designed to engage local elders and community leaders, creating intergenerational connections that can enrich the discussions and foster a deeper understanding of cultural heritage.

The success of the listening circles will rely on ongoing community involvement and readiness to participate in these culturally grounded initiatives. By cultivating a network of support that values the contributions of Native youth, Oklahoma can help create a stronger foundation for their personal and communal growth. Ultimately, these listening circles will promote healing, resilience, and a renewed sense of identity among Native youth, contributing positively to their overall well-being.
